
Driftless 100
Gravel cycling fundraiser in Clayton County with 100/50/25 mile courses across hilly gravel roads
Welcome to the Driftless 100, formerly the Volga City Gravel Race. Our event is designed as a fundraiser for the local EMS crews in Clayton County, Iowa. All proceeds go towards the improvement of equipment and supplies of local Emergency crews.
The Race itself comes in 3 distances: 100, 50 and 25 miles. 90–95% of each course is gravel with a few miles of level B, blacktop and bike trail included. There are hills in this area of the state, some rollers but a lot of steep semi-short climbs that will get the legs going no matter what level of rider you are. The estimated average for climbing is 100 feet per mile.
If you are looking for an additional incentive for your spring training we are doing a custom prize for any rider who breaks the 8 hour mark on the 100 mile course (12.5 MPH average).
